Burglary Alert Kenilworth!

Burglaries at homes in Glebe Crescent, School Lane & Clarendon Road, Kenilworth & Cromwell Lane, Burton Green
Please be aware of the following incidents which have occurred at homes in Kenilworth over rtecent days.
Incident 434 of 18 June
At some point before 10.30pm on 18 June offenders forced open the rear door of a home in Glebe Crescent, Kenilworth.  This activated the intruder alarm.  The offenders managed to steal several items before making off.
Incident 360 of 19 June
Between 10am on 17 and 8pm on 18 June offenders entered a home in School Lane, Kenilworth and stole an IPod from the dining room.
Incident 79 of 18 June

During the night of 17 into 18 June offenders forced the padlock off a rear garden shed at a home in Clarendon Road, Kenilworth.  Once inside the shed the offenders carried out a thorough search before making off with 2 pedal cycles, a scooter, several remote control cars and other items.
Incident 339 of 18 June

Between 1am on 11 June and 3pm on 16 June offenders stole a feature fibreglass water feature statue in the shape of a St Bernard dog from the front garden of a home in Cromwell Lane, Coventry.
Please remain alert, on the lookout for suspicious persons, vehicles or activity around your own or neighbouring homes and please report anything out of place or, of concern, to Police on 101.  Thankyou.

Burglaries in Fieldgate Lane & Warwick Road


Please be aware of the following incidents which have occurred at homes in Kenilworth over the past few days.
Fieldgate Lane 8 May
During the night of 7th May into 8th May offenders entered a home in Fieldgate Lane, Kenilworth through the rear patio doors and stole several items.
Warwick Road 10 May

Between midnight on 8th May and midnight on 9th May offenders forced open a first floor wooden front door of a home in Warwick Road, Kenilworth and entered the premises to steal items of electrical equipment.

Help Needed – Alert for sightings of Silver Fiesta

 

Please could you be actively on the lookout for a silver Ford Fiesta, registration number W68 VOJ around your area or as you travel about the county.

This vehicle and its three occupants are believed to be linked to burglaries and thefts from vehicles in Whitnash, Tiddington, Hampton Lucy, Warwick and Shipston. The offenders are usually active overnight and in the early hours.
Warwickshire Police are obviously very keen to catch these offenders so, if you spot this vehicle please dial 999 and report its whereabouts immediately.  Please also say that you are responding to a Watch message.

Appeal for Vigilance – Vehicle FN56 TTY – Grey Volkswagen Golf GTI

Warwickshire Police are asking residents in the Kenilworth area to keep a keen lookout for a Grey VW Golf GTI Automatic FN56 TTY. This vehicle is believed have been involved in burglaries in Exhall, Bulkington, Rugby & Southam over the last few days.

The vehicle is believed to be on False Plates but this has not been confirmed at this time. Locating this vehicle is a Warwickshire Police priority and they need our help to find it.

If you spot the vehicle in your area please contact Police on 999 and report its whereabouts immediately so that the suspects can be arrested.

Police believe the suspects are from Coventry and work is underway to identify them. Patrols have been increased in and around Exhall, Bulkington and the main arterial routes between Coventry and Rugby including Southam but this vehicle may pop up elsewhere so please be vigilant.

Vehicle Broken into – Laneham Place (off Coventry Road), Kenilworth

Theft from Motor Vehicle – Laneham Place, Kenilworth (Incident 170 of 26 January 2012)
Please be aware that between Midnight and 0830hrs 26 January 2012 offenders entered a secure and unattended Landrover Defender parked in Laneham Place and stole a SatNav from the central compartment.
Please remain alert and vigilant in relation to protecting your property and remove those items of value from vehicles and from sight. Please report anything suspicious or of concern to the Police tel 101.
